Ok i have just cleaned the sensor, and WOW what an amazing difference............!!!

I took few shots of blue skies & white skies of F22 before and they where very dusty, now after the clean i took some more at F22 and no signs at all of dust bunnies,I used 3 swabs which work out at £1.50 in total :)

1 question though, Looking through the view finder i can stills see tiny darker spots, these are not appearing on the pictures so where could these be, they appear using various lens's

yes, definitely stay away from the mirror as it is finished with some sort of etching or a texture thus renders is unswabable, I like to use compressed air (very lightly) against the mirror before I clean the sensor since the mirror does not like being swabbed.
